摘要

Bioelectrical impedance analysis technology was used tomeasure whole body parameters and electrical resistance and reactance of specific body regions in schizophrenia patients after long-term medication use. Patient data was compared to that of a control group of subjects to analyze metabolic differences. Our experimental group was composed of 60 schizophrenia patients, and the control group was composed of 30 normal subjects. T-test and ANOVA analyses were conducted to compared differences between groups, with confidencev intervals set at 95%. T-test results showed significant differences in body fat levels between groups (F=4.753, p=0.031<;0.05). Additionally, we also found significant differences in upper body resistance and reactance (F=78.433, p=0.000<;0.05, F=67.488, p=0.000<;0.05), which could be related to accumulation of body fat. These results show correlation between schizophrenia and development of metabolic syndrome.
机译:生物电阻抗分析技术用于测量精神分裂症患者长期服用药物后的全身参数以及特定身体部位的电阻和电抗。将患者数据与对照组的患者数据进行比较,以分析代谢差异。我们的实验组由60名精神分裂症患者组成,对照组由30名正常受试者组成。进行T检验和ANOVA分析以比较组之间的差异,置信区间设置为95%。 T检验结果显示两组之间的体内脂肪水平存在显着差异(F = 4.753,p = 0.031 <; 0.05)。此外,我们还发现上身抵抗力和电抗存在显着差异(F = 78.433,p = 0.000 <; 0.05,F = 67.488,p = 0.000 <; 0.05),这可能与体内脂肪的积累有关。这些结果表明精神分裂症和代谢综合征的发展之间的相关性。
